A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

雨敲窗

初级黑马

  • 黑马币:

  • 帖子:

  • 精华:

© 雨敲窗 初级黑马   /  2018-8-30 01:06  /  375 人查看  /  0 人回复  /   0 人收藏 转载请遵从CC协议 禁止商业使用本文

1.1 程序编写
我们在整个Java学习阶段均是在学习如何完成软件编写,由于到目前为止,没有学习任何语法,所以在HelloWorld案例当中,我们直接使用模板代码,完成编写过程。
程序的编写过程与写文档类似,只是文档是.txt文件,其内容为文字。Java程序员编写的代码又叫源代码,是.java文件,其内容为符合Java语法的代码。
1.2 程序编译
1.2.1 编译
编译是Java程序完成的必不可少的过程,是将源代码.java文件,转为Java程序.class文件的过程,即程序员写的源代码与真正运行的java程序并不是一个文件。所以需要将程序员写的java源代码生成可以运行的Java程序(.class文件)。我们使用Java提供的Javac.exe完成java文件编译成.class文件。
Windows通过Javac.exe将.java文件生成对应的.class文件。
1.2.2 编译步骤
编译动作与后边的运行动作都需要使用到DOS界面,现在可以将DOS简单的理解为命令行界面。因为java的编译命令javac.exe,与后边学习的运行命令java.exe在windows下无法直接运行,必须使用命令行界面。
开启DOS窗口。打开方式:win+r运行cmd。
开启DOS窗口后,使用CD命令将目录切换到.java所在目录
这里涉及到简单DOS命令:
盘符:切换到指定盘符(如C盘,D盘)
cd:用于进入到指定文件夹
cd  .java文件所在目录

使用javac命令编译
javac是安装Java后,Java的编译工具,使用该工具,完成 .java转为.class文件,调用完该命令后会在.java所在的文件夹下生成对应的.class文件,该文件就是真正可运行的程序。
javac  XXX.java  →  XXX.class
1.2.3 程序运行
JavaSE基础阶段的Java程序运行是一个很简单的步骤,直接使用java,但是需要同学们严格区分程序编写与程序运行,不要混淆。
我们使用Java提供的java.exe直接运行即可。
格式:
java  XXX(不带扩展名)
注释、关键字与标识符
1.3 注释
用来解释和说明程序的文字。案例中的代码我们并不知道什么意思,我们可以使用注释来提醒自己我的代码的功能是什么。注释是不会被执行的。

格式
单行注释    //注释内容
多行注释    /*注释内容*/
文档注释 /**注释内容*/

注释的进一步解释
对于单行和多行注释,被注释的文字,不会被JVM解释执行。
对于文档注释,是java特有的注释,其中注释内容可以被JDK提供的工具 javadoc 所解析,生成一套以网页文件形式体现的该程序的说明文档。在文档注释中可以使用注解配合javadoc完成对信息的进一步说明。
注释是一个程序员必须要具有的良好编程习惯。便于自己日后的代码维护,也方便别人阅读你的代码。
HelloWorld注释说明
/*
class:类,Java当中组织代码的基本单位
HelloWorld:类名,可自定义,必须与文件名一致
public:访问权限修饰符,现为固定写法
static:静态修饰符,现为固定写法
void:返回值类型,现为固定写法
main:方法名,现为固定写法
String[]:参数类型,现为固定写法
args:参数名,可以自定义修改,建议固定写为args
*/
public class HelloWorld {
/*
main方法是程序入口,即JVM从main方法处开始运行程序。
*/
public static void main(String[] args) {
//打印语句
//小括号内为打印字符串语句,字符串必须使用""包裹
System.out.println("Hello World!");
}
}

0 个回复

您需要登录后才可以回帖 登录 | 加入黑马